Wonder, surprise, and new possibilities are stamped on the very nature of Jesus’ resurrection.  Things are not what they appear to be.  Tyrants don’t always win.  Confusion gives birth to insight.  Jesus appears in unexpected ways. Rules we thought were hard and fast no longer apply.  The book of Acts confronts us with what becomes possible in a post-Easter world.  Acts shows us the values that come with Jesus’ empty tomb, and prompts us to consider the nature of an authentically Christian witness.  To what, exactly, are we bearing witness as people who believe that death and the powers of this world do not have the last word?  What kind of testimony do we offer, as people whose encounters with a living Christ make us reject the cynical assumption that nothing will ever change, in our lives or in the world?  Throughout the Easter season we will be considering these questions and more as we experience and live out the Resurrection Values of Jesus.
